Citrix Virtual Apps and Desktops - Intermittent Black background behind pop-up windows in a Published Application

Description

In some cases, customers are seeing a black background appear when a pop-up window is present in a published application. The black background shows up behind the main application window, but does not span the entire screen.

Applications are published from a multi-session VDA running CVAD 2507 on Windows Server 2025.

This issue was not seen in earlier versions of the VDA or Windows Server.

Cause

The black window is related to snap layouts (as seen in Windows 11 when you drag a window to the top of the screen). This is a transparent window owned by the ShellAppRuntime process. Currently, transparent windows are not supported in published applications. a

Resolution

In the long term, this will be addressed when transparent window support is added in a future CVAD release, but in the short term, the current recommendation is disable the snap bar with the following registry setting on the VDA

H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Explorer\Advanced
EnableSnapBar DWORD 0x0
